What I Check About the Condition

If I am buying a physical copy, I always inspect the disc, case, and manual. I prefer a copy with minimal scratches and complete packaging because that usually feels more collectible and reliable. My advice is to ask about testing if the game is used, since older discs can sometimes have issues.

Compatibility I Keep in Mind

I make sure I have the right system to play it. Since this is an original Xbox game, I check whether my console can run it properly. If I plan to use it on a newer setup, I verify backward compatibility first so I do not end up with a game I cannot play.
